Jay and I thought of adding a little bonus bragging rights for the best fishing/hunting report of the week. Although you don't necessarily have to catch/harvest anything. The value of reports to other members is important. Only one report each week will be selected. This week report will be selected on Saturday. The report contest will run all week long from Saturday to the following Saturday.
**Please do not post reports in this Forum we will pick the winner of each week, and add them into the Forum
For The Report Of The Week Forum selection you must describe the following.
1. Describing tactics, water temps, body of water, boating/nonboating, clearity of water, and weather conditions are all very important aspects of a well written report.
2. If its a hunting report although hard to take photo's of the actual hunt ect. Describe weather conditions, temp, time of day, locations describe the general area. Example "I went hunting today in Westfield" and if your successful photos of your harvested animal are a must.
3. Photo's of Scenery, Fish, harvested animal, or you and your group enjoying the outdoors.
4. Fish/Animal has to be caught or harvested in the state Massachusetts.
5. This is soley for bragging rights and another way of sharing information to new anglers/hunters.
